What is the best way to meet people?

How would you meet people with the same interest?

You would join a club.

Types of clubs:

–Hobbies –Sports –Interests–Politics –Religion –Personal problems–Pets

Unusual clubs–People who like having a snake for a pet.–People who are afraid of milk

To make this club more interesting, what would you organize?

Some examples

•Have to dress up as your favourite character.

•Have an annual meeting

•Reenact scenes from a movie or book known as role-playing

•Discussion groups

•Competitions
